>> Yes, the default posture of a Scorpion is tergient in the SCA Glossary.
>>   Consider versus "Checky sable and vert, a scorpion displayed queue forché Or."  (Josiah Scorpius, Device, Oct 79).
>>   I see 1 CD for the field only.  Displayed and tergient are the same posture and a 2nd tail isn't worth a CD.  Pity.
>>   In redesign be aware that Al-Barran has a (fieldless) Badge with a charged Or scorpion which your design is currently clear of.
